Red Cardinal Weigela
Red Cardinal Weigela is a striking deciduous shrub loved for its profusion of deep red blooms that appear in late spring and often rebloom in summer. Its lush green foliage and vibrant flowers make it an excellent choice for borders, mixed beds, and foundation plantings. Low-maintenance and pollinator-friendly, this shrub adds long-lasting color to your landscape.
- Bright red trumpet-shaped blooms
- Mature Height: 48 inches
- ☀️ Full Sun to Partial Shade
- Attracts hummingbirds and butterflies
- Ideal for borders and mixed garden beds
Tip: Prune right after flowering to maintain its shape and encourage repeat blooms.
Growing Zones: 4–8 outdoors

| Mature Height: | 48 inches |
| Sunlight: | Full Sun to Partial Shade |
| Mature Width: | 48–60 inches |
| Botanical Name: | Weigela florida 'Red Prince' |
| Growth Rate: | Moderate |
| Bloom Time: | Late Spring with Summer Rebloom |
| Type: | Shrub |
FAQ's
How tall does Red Cardinal Weigela grow?
It typically grows about 48 inches tall with a spread of 48–60 inches.
What makes Red Cardinal Weigela special?
Its deep red flowers create a dramatic look and attract hummingbirds and butterflies.
Does it need pruning?
Prune after flowering to maintain shape and encourage additional blooms.
Where does Red Cardinal Weigela grow best?
It thrives in USDA Zones 4–8 in full sun to partial shade with well-drained soil.
